AMD Ryzen 3 5300U and NVIDIA GeForce RTX 2060

Calculator result

AMD Ryzen 3 5300U and NVIDIA GeForce RTX 2060 can run Dota 2 game on 1920 × 1080 (FHD (1080p)) resolution with frames per second ranging from 83.9 FPS up to 314.5 FPS depending on game settings.

  • On ultra settings this configuration can achieve from 83.9 FPS up to 125.8 FPS , with average around 104.8 FPS .
  • On high settings this configuration can achieve from 134.2 FPS up to 201.3 FPS , with average around 167.7 FPS .
  • On medium settings this configuration can achieve from 167.7 FPS up to 251.6 FPS , with average around 209.7 FPS .
  • On low settings this configuration can achieve from 209.7 FPS up to 314.5 FPS , with average around 262.1 FPS .
